What is the fee of Allied school?
TODDLERS TO CLASS X
| Description | |
|---|---|
| Monthly Tuition Fee (Full Fee Category) | 3700/- |
| Monthly Tuition Fee (Sibling Fee Category) | 2800/- |
| Admission Fee (At the time of admission for all student categories) | 2500/- |
| Security Deposit (Refundable) | 2500/- |

How much does it cost to get your real estate license in California?
California state fees to become a real estate salesperson include a $60 exam fee and $245 licensing fee. Other costs include Pre-Licensing course tuition, which can range anywhere from $125 up to $700 depending on the package and the provider.

Is the CA real estate exam hard?
So, is the California real estate exam hard to pass? The California real estate salesperson exam isn’t easy to pass. According to education providers in the state, the pass rate averages around 50 percent or less.
How long does it take to become a licensed real estate agent in California?
On average, it takes between five (5) and six (6) months to get a California real estate license depending on the pace in which you complete the 135 hours of pre-licensing courses and pass your licensing examination, the time it takes you to complete the application process and find a sponsoring broker, and application …

Is Allied Schools accredited in the US?
Allied Schools is nationally accredited by the Accrediting Commission of the Distance Education and Training Council (DETC). The Accrediting Commission of the Distance Education and Training Council is listed by the U.S. Department of Education as a nationally-recognized accrediting agency.
